Who is Scooby1961?
Born in 1963, in the United States of America, Scooby Werkstatt is both a YouTube personality and a fitness enthusiast, best known for his YouTube channel Scooby1961, which focuses on easy-to-digest free fitness tips. He has extensive bodybuilding experience, having lifted weights consistently for decades.

Early life and fitness beginnings
Scooby was not the type to engage in sports or physical fitness activities during his childhood. He was clumsy, clumsy and lanky even when he reached the age of 21. However, he longed for a body worth showing off on the beach, but he was an introvert and did not want to go to a gym where many people gathered. To compromise, he started buying simple weightlifting equipment for home use.
Eventually, as he learned more about bodybuilding, he gained confidence in the small results he saw in his body.
This marked a change for him as he started looking for other physical activities. He loved sports and physical activities, taking breaks only a few times a year. His self-esteem grew and soon he was involved in various sports, including surfing, swimming, rollerblading, volleyball, hiking, running and many other activities. His passion only grew and he realized that a gym membership was not necessary to achieve his fitness goals.
Training Style and Scooby Workshop
With decades of experience, Scooby has created several home gym programs that mainly focus on body weight exercises, which are versatile and most movements can be done anywhere, making them very flexible even for busy people.

When it comes to equipment, he mainly promotes the use of dumbbells and barbells. He believes that minimal equipment is the most you need as the fitness industry has become greedy and offers various products that people don’t need to build a good body.
Apart from that, good muscle mass is directly related to a good diet. Since Scooby has learned more about nutrition and exercise, he prides himself on maintaining a body he’s had since he was 20. Wanting to share his progress and knowledge, he then created the website Scooby Workshop in 2004, which was born out of the fitness industry’s frustration in dealing with money.
That’s why all of his videos, articles, and advice are free, as he wants to help those who don’t have a lot of money achieve their fitness goals. Eventually, thanks to his website, he gained a little more fame.
YouTube and adjust for age
Scooby also saw the opportunity to increase its online presence and reach more people through the website YouTube. The online platform is a very popular option among fitness enthusiasts and professionals who want to share their expertise. It’s a way to promote products or generate additional revenue through Google’s advertising revenue, which pays them for the number of people who view ads on their channel.
Like his website, his YouTube channel started gaining followers quickly, eventually reaching over 500,000 in a short time. Many of his fans call him YouTube’s “Father of Fitness” because he was one of the first to settle on the site, and because of his age.
At the age of 50, Scooby has toned down from lifting weights, feeling that it is no longer possible for him to gain muscle mass. Instead, he modified his training to focus more on sports-related workouts and exercises that would improve his stamina. This led to a different path as he started participating in cycling races and then triathlons.
These competitions are mainly focused on endurance and a well-trained cardiovascular fitness. He enjoys this new direction in his fitness life and has since incorporated his new knowledge and experience into his online content.
Favorite exercises and nutrition
Scooby’s experience is that getting in shape takes a lot of time and fitness. Even as the fitness industry develops ways to speed up the pace of a person getting in shape, he believes these are just quick fixes. As for core workouts, he believes in using body weight and training the overall abs, rather than focusing on exercises that help create aesthetically pleasing abs. While he does a lot of weightlifting,
the most important exercises for him are the push-up and pull-up. He also believes that triceps training is most important for bigger arms, and that leg exercises are very important to avoid injury, especially if one is active in sports.
While there is a strong focus on exercise, Scooby prioritizes nutrition as the most important part of his lifestyle. He keeps track of his calories and most of the meals he prepares are easy to make. He offers cooking and eating tips in his online accounts and does not use supplements, believing there are many Too good to be true.
